Polemi Beach Kos lies about 32 km southwest of Kos Town, near the village of Kefalos. It is a peaceful and secluded beach, offering fine golden sand and clear, turquoise waters. Surrounded by lush greenery and hills, it provides a calm and natural environment.

The beach is semi-organized, with some sunbeds and umbrellas available for rent. In addition, a small beach bar near the entrance offers drinks and snacks. The shallow waters make it ideal for families with children. 

However, reaching Polemi Beach requires traveling along a dirt road, which can be rough. Despite the challenging terrain, the drive rewards visitors with stunning views of the coastline and surrounding nature.
